The relation of existing blood pressure and subsequent development of hypertension to antecedent measures of adiposity was investigated in 5,127 adult men and women being followed biennially for the development of atherosclerotic and hypertensive vascular disease in the Framingham Study since 1949. Relative body weight, weight change under observation, and skinfold thickness was found to be distinctly related to existing blood pressure level and to the subsequent rate of development of hypertension. The risk of hypertension in previously normotensive individuals was proportional to the degree of overweight however assessed. The possibility of a substantial artifact in indirect blood pressure determination in subjects with fat arms was excluded by an examination of the relation of adiposity to blood pressure as obtained in the relatively lean forearm as well as the upper arm. Within the range of arm girths in this population, no effect of arm girth on blood pressure independent of the associated degree of adiposity could be demonstrated. Whether or not the rise in blood pressure observed to occur with increase in body build is directly due to the accumulation of adipose tissue remains unanswered. The finding that lean hypertensives had an increased tendency to develop obesity as well as the converse, and that already obese normotensive subjects developed hypertension only after some time lag, suggests a relationship which is neither simple nor direct. It seems reasonable to conclude that adiposity predisposes and makes a significant contribution to development of hypertension in adult men and women beyond age 30. This is not the result of a blood pressure artifact due to a larger arm circumference.
